Southampton 1-1 Town Tue 06th Mar 2012 21:50
Jason Scotland’s late deflected goal secured the Blues a deserved 1-1 draw at Southampton. The Saints went ahead in the 74th minute via top scorer Rickie Lambert but Scotland’s goal five minutes from the end claimed the point for Town.

Town 3-0 Bristol City Sat 03rd Mar 2012 17:07
Goals from Michael Chopra, Tommy Smith and Andy Drury saw the Blues to a very comfortable 3-0 home victory over Bristol City. Chopra nodded in his 13th of the season from a Lee Martin cross in the 25th minute, Smith powered home a Drury corner on 66 with the midfielder lashing home the third with five minutes remaining.

Town Still in for Portsmouth Trio Fri 02nd Mar 2012 22:15
Chief executive Simon Clegg has revealed that Town's move to sign Portsmouth trio Jason Pearce, Joel Ward and Stephen Henderson (pictured) is still “a live issue”. On the final day of the January transfer window, the Blues had offers for keeper Henderson and midfielder or defender Ward accepted, the deals breaking down due to the players’ wage demands, while Pompey rebuffed bids from Town and others for centre-half Pearce.

Smith Back and Feeling Good Fri 02nd Mar 2012 09:13
Centre-half Tommy Smith is back in Suffolk and on his way to Town training after his gruelling round trip to New Zealand for their friendly against Jamaica on Wednesday, which the All Whites lost 3-2. The 21-year-old says he’s feeling fine despite his three-leg flight arriving in the UK early this morning.
